[0019] Example 1:
[0020] One using supercritical CO 2 The method of variable temperature and variable pressure extraction of Ganoderma lucidum spore oil is as follows:
[0021] ①Put 10kg of Ganoderma lucidum spores into an ultrafine pulverizer, and break the walls by low-temperature physical methods, and control the wall breaking rate above 99% to obtain Ganoderma lucidum spore powder;
[0022] ②Pour the broken Ganoderma lucidum spore powder into the mixer, while stirring, add 60% pure water (the pure water in this example is distilled water) of the raw material weight, and use a one-step granulator to dry at 60°C until the moisture content is less than 6% Under the environment, dry-pressing method is used to make 40 mesh particles;
